public class PercolatorUtils extends Object
| Constructor and Description |
|---|
PercolatorUtils() |
| Modifier and Type | Method and Description |
|---|---|
static String |
getHeader(com.compomics.util.parameters.identification.search.SearchParameters searchParameters,
Boolean rtPredictionsAvailable)
Returns the header of the Percolator training file.
|
static String |
getPeptideData(com.compomics.util.experiment.identification.matches.SpectrumMatch spectrumMatch,
com.compomics.util.experiment.identification.spectrum_assumptions.PeptideAssumption peptideAssumption,
Boolean rtPredictionsAvailable,
ArrayList<Double> predictedRts,
com.compomics.util.parameters.identification.search.SearchParameters searchParameters,
com.compomics.util.experiment.io.biology.protein.SequenceProvider sequenceProvider,
com.compomics.util.parameters.identification.advanced.SequenceMatchingParameters sequenceMatchingParameters,
com.compomics.util.experiment.identification.spectrum_annotation.AnnotationParameters annotationParameters,
com.compomics.util.parameters.identification.advanced.ModificationLocalizationParameters modificationLocalizationParameters,
com.compomics.util.experiment.biology.modifications.ModificationFactory modificationFactory,
com.compomics.util.experiment.mass_spectrometry.SpectrumProvider spectrumProvider)
Gets the peptide data to provide to percolator.
|
static long |
getPeptideKey(String peptideData)
Returns a unique key corresponding to the given peptide.
|
public static String getHeader(com.compomics.util.parameters.identification.search.SearchParameters searchParameters, Boolean rtPredictionsAvailable)
searchParameters - The parameters of the search.rtPredictionsAvailable - Flag indicating whether RT predictions are
given.public static String getPeptideData(com.compomics.util.experiment.identification.matches.SpectrumMatch spectrumMatch, com.compomics.util.experiment.identification.spectrum_assumptions.PeptideAssumption peptideAssumption, Boolean rtPredictionsAvailable, ArrayList<Double> predictedRts, com.compomics.util.parameters.identification.search.SearchParameters searchParameters, com.compomics.util.experiment.io.biology.protein.SequenceProvider sequenceProvider, com.compomics.util.parameters.identification.advanced.SequenceMatchingParameters sequenceMatchingParameters, com.compomics.util.experiment.identification.spectrum_annotation.AnnotationParameters annotationParameters, com.compomics.util.parameters.identification.advanced.ModificationLocalizationParameters modificationLocalizationParameters, com.compomics.util.experiment.biology.modifications.ModificationFactory modificationFactory, com.compomics.util.experiment.mass_spectrometry.SpectrumProvider spectrumProvider)
spectrumMatch - The spectrum match where the peptide was found.peptideAssumption - The peptide assumption.rtPredictionsAvailable - Flag indicating whether retention time
predictions are given.predictedRts - The retention time predictions for this peptide.searchParameters - The parameters of the search.sequenceProvider - The sequence provider.sequenceMatchingParameters - The sequence matching parameters.annotationParameters - The annotation parameters.modificationLocalizationParameters - The modification localization
parameters.modificationFactory - The factory containing the modification
details.spectrumProvider - The spectrum provider.public static long getPeptideKey(String peptideData)
peptideData - The peptide data as string.Copyright © 2021. All rights reserved.